How To Choose The Best Case For S24 Ultra

Selecting a Case For S24 Ultra requires evaluating four interdependent factors: the material compound’s energy absorption under impact, the magnet array’s strength without interfering with the S Pen digitizer, the kickstand’s hinge durability over repeated use, and the overall profile’s effect on pocket fit and wireless charging pass-through. Ignoring any one of these creates a weak link in your protection strategy.

Material Layering and Corner Impact Geometry

A single-layer TPU case flexes too much at the corners, allowing the phone to twist against the ground. Look for a dual-layer design that sandwiches a rigid polycarbonate backplate with a soft TPU bumper. The S24 Ultra’s squared-off corners concentrate drop force into four small points — a case must have air-gap cushioning or honeycomb ribs specifically at those corners to dissipate kinetic energy before it reaches the glass.

Magnetic Integration and S Pen Interference

Not all magnets are created equal. A poorly positioned or weak magnet ring can misalign wireless charging coils, causing slow charging or overheating. More critically, a unshielded magnetic field can distort the S Pen’s electromagnetic resonance layer, creating input lag or phantom touches. Premium cases use 36-piece N52 neodymium arrays precisely spaced to avoid interference — check customer reviews specifically for S Pen performance before buying.

Kickstand Structural Integrity

The kickstand is the most common failure point on a Case For S24 Ultra. Avoid stands made from flexible TPU — they bend permanently within weeks. Aerospace-grade aluminum or zinc-alloy hinges with a positive-lock mechanism survive thousands of cycles. The stand must also be recessed into the backplate, not protruding, to prevent wobbling when the phone is placed flat on a desk.

Hardware & Specs Guide

TPU vs Polycarbonate vs Hybrid Armor

Thermoplastic Polyurethane (TPU) is the most common case material because it flexes to absorb low-energy drops, but it degrades under UV light and offers minimal structural rigidity. Polycarbonate (PC) is a hard plastic that resists impact by distributing force across its surface, but it cracks under concentrated point loads. Hybrid armor layers a PC backplate over a TPU bumper, combining the stiffness of PC with the flexibility of TPU — this is the ideal configuration for the S24 Ultra’s 6.8-inch frame because it prevents the phone from twisting on impact.

Magnetic Flux and Wireless Charging Efficiency

The S24 Ultra supports up to 15W wireless charging via the Qi standard, and a case’s built-in magnet ring must be within ±0.5mm alignment tolerance to maintain that speed. Magnets rated below N48 often fail to center the phone on the charging coil, reducing charging efficiency to 5W-7W. N52-grade magnets (as found in the Dexnor) provide the strongest hold with the thinnest magnetic footprint. Verify that the case’s magnet ring is positioned near the phone’s center — not offset toward the camera bump — to ensure consistent power transfer.

FAQ

Will a magnetic case interfere with the S Pen on the S24 Ultra?
Yes, poorly shielded magnets can distort the S Pen’s electromagnetic resonance field, causing input lag, phantom touches, or cursor drift. Premium cases like the Dexnor use a 36-piece N52 magnet array with precise spacing to avoid interference. If you use the S Pen heavily, choose a case with verified reviews stating no S Pen issues — or opt for a non-magnetic case like the Spigen Liquid Air.
How long does a clear TPU case last before yellowing?
Standard clear TPU begins to show visible yellowing after 3 to 6 months of daily UV exposure, depending on sunlight intensity and ambient heat. Some manufacturers add UV inhibitors to slow the process, but no clear TPU is immune to discoloration. If you want long-term clarity, choose a case with a polycarbonate backplate and TPU bumper — the PC back will stay clear longer than an all-TPU design.
